5.6.4 Unit Reset
This section allows you to reset specific parts of the device. This involves resetting keyboard/mouse,
USB, video engine, or the IP-KVM device itself.
In general, the IP-KVM requires a reset when implementing a firmware update. In the event of an
abnormal operation, a number of subsystems may be reset without resetting the entire IP-KVM.
Click Maintenance > Unit Reset, the following window displays.
Figure 5-34 Unit Reset
To reset a certain IP-KVM functionality click on the Reset button as displayed in figure below.
Clicking on Reset of Reset Device will reboot the IP-KVM system.
It will close all current
connections to the administration console and to the Remote Console. The whole process will take about one
minute. Resetting subdevices (e.g. video engine) will take few seconds only and does not result in closing
connections.
Note: Only the super user is allowed to reset the IP-KVM.
